Cats are able to get pregnant as early as 4 months old. The best way to prevent your cat from becoming pregnant is to have her surgically sterilized an ovariohysterectomy or spay operation before she has her first estrous cycle. Kitties mature young typically between 4 and 6 months old.

The average female cat will first go into heat or cycle between 6-9 months of age but heat cycles can start as early as 4 months of age and as late as 12 months. But thats just an estimate. Female cats queens can become sexually mature from just four months of age.
